First, you’ll need to complete and submit the Common Application. Alongside the Common Application, you’ll need to include your school report, a counselor recommendation, and two teacher evaluations.

WebThe annual list price to attend Cornell University on a full time basis for 2024/2024 is $80,287 for all students regardless of their residency. This fee is comprised of $60,286 for tuition, $16,396 room and board, $1,000 for books and supplies and $729 for other fees. Out of state tuition for Cornell University is $60,286, the same as New York ... WebThe Cornell University campus is located in Ithaca, NY and is characterized as City: Small (population less than 100,000).
